3、tee of the IEEE Microwave Theory and Techniques Society Approved 15 May 2016 IEEE-SA Standards BoardAbstract: Recommendations for summarizing the performance and the expected uncertainty of the re ection coef cient of rectangular-waveguide apertures and interfaces for 110 GHz and above are provided
4、in this recommended practice. The information provided also facilitates the develop- ment of a complete uncertainty analysis for the performance of rectangular waveguide interfaces. For example, it includes the dimensional information essential for calculating the uncertainty of both re ection and t
5、ransmission coef cients through interfaces provided by different manufacturers if both follow this recommended practice.
